Job Title:

Associate Director, Lab Services

Department:

University Hospital | Lab Administration

Scope of Position

The Ohio State University Wexner Medical Center Clinical Laboratories are committed to improving people's lives through innovation in research, education, and patient care. The Associate Director provides leadership and development to managers and specialized staff and ensures consistency of operations between clinical laboratories, anatomic pathology, medical center leadership and various departments throughout the Medical Center. The Associate Director works with members of the faculty and staff to ensure the provision of high-quality patient care while ensuring the financial viability of the programs, benchmarking, productivity objectives, development, and implementation of strategic growth plans, operational, financial, facilities, outreach, and other business activities across the system. The clinical labs are responsible for pre-analytic, analytic, and post-analytic functions on clinical specimens to obtain information about the health of a patient pertaining to the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of disease, assisting care providers with clinical information related to patient care, education, and research.

Position Summary

The Associate Director provides leadership and expertise as they develop, align, and operationalize the program's clinical, academic, and research activities to support the overall OSUWMC goals and implement key initiatives through interdisciplinary collaboration. The Associate Director assists with oversight of the department(s), including fiscal management, operational metrics and dashboards, position control management, contract management, project/operational support, facilities support, audit coordination and compliance, strategic planning, and all other administrative and operational management matters specific to the department(s). The Associate Director promotes an environment that facilitates patient and staff satisfaction and a culture of team development and professional growth and participates in professional organizations and workgroups to promote the organization's image externally. This role will also support a strategic vision for growth or improvements that will enhance the department operations and support the laboratories, including auditing external client relationships regarding payment, billing, and services. This position directly reports to the Operations Director and works with the Division and Medical Directors.

Minimum Qualifications

For Hire: Bachelor's Degree in Biological Sciences, Health related Sciences or equivalent combination of education and experience. American Society of Clinical Pathology Certification in Medical Technologist or Medical Lab Scientist. 7 years of relevant experience required. 12 or more years of relevant experience preferred.

Ongoing: Maintains certification status and continue to attend meetings and seminars to stay current in all areas

of discipline. Meets mandatory education and health surveillance requirements. Demonstrates competence in the technical, interpersonal, and cognitive skills required to perform the essential job functions.
